Your message dated Tue, 23 Nov 2021 22:37:30 +0000
with message-id <e1mpepq-000h8y...@fasolo.debian.org>
and subject line Bug#1000471: fixed in glewlwyd 2.6.0-1
has caused the Debian Bug report #1000471,
regarding glewlwyd FTBFS can't find functions.
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)
--
1000471: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1000471
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: glewlwyd
Version: 2.5.2-3
Severity: serious
Tags: ftbfs
Unfortunately it seems that even after the cross-fetch fix, glewlwyd still
FTBFS as a
result of changes in iddawc/rhonabwy.
/usr/bin/cc -D_GNU_SOURCE -Dschememodoauth2_EXPORTS -I/include -g -O2
-ffile-prefix-map=/<<PKGBUILDDIR>>=. -fstack-protector-strong -Wformat
-Werror=format-security -Wdate-time -D_FORTIFY_SOURCE=2 -Wall -Werror -fPIC -Wextra -std=gnu99 -MD -MT
CMakeFiles/schememodoauth2.dir/src/scheme/oauth2.c.o -MF
CMakeFiles/schememodoauth2.dir/src/scheme/oauth2.c.o.d -o
CMakeFiles/schememodoauth2.dir/src/scheme/oauth2.c.o -c /<<PKGBUILDDIR>>/src/scheme/oauth2.c
/<<PKGBUILDDIR>>/src/scheme/oauth2.c: In function 'complete_session_identify':
/<<PKGBUILDDIR>>/src/scheme/oauth2.c:265:32: error: implicit declaration of
function 'i_load_userinfo'; did you mean 'i_get_userinfo'?
[-Werror=implicit-function-declaration]
265 | if ((res = i_load_userinfo(&i_session)) == I_OK &&
i_session.j_userinfo != NULL) {
| ^~~~~~~~~~~~~~~
| i_get_userinfo
/<<PKGBUILDDIR>>/src/scheme/oauth2.c: In function
'user_auth_scheme_module_init':
/<<PKGBUILDDIR>>/src/scheme/oauth2.c:1197:28: error: implicit declaration of
function 'i_load_openid_config'; did you mean 'i_get_openid_config'?
[-Werror=implicit-function-declaration]
1197 | } else if (i_load_openid_config(&i_session) != I_OK) {
| ^~~~~~~~~~~~~~~~~~~~
| i_get_openid_config
make -f CMakeFiles/protocol_oidc.dir/build.make
CMakeFiles/protocol_oidc.dir/depend
<-------snip---->
/usr/bin/cc -D_GNU_SOURCE -Dprotocol_register_EXPORTS -I/include -g -O2
-ffile-prefix-map=/<<PKGBUILDDIR>>=. -fstack-protector-strong -Wformat
-Werror=format-security -Wdate-time -D_FORTIFY_SOURCE=2 -Wall -Werror -fPIC -Wextra -std=gnu99 -MD -MT
CMakeFiles/protocol_register.dir/src/plugin/register.c.o -MF
CMakeFiles/protocol_register.dir/src/plugin/register.c.o.d -o
CMakeFiles/protocol_register.dir/src/plugin/register.c.o -c
/<<PKGBUILDDIR>>/src/plugin/register.c
/<<PKGBUILDDIR>>/src/plugin/protocol_oidc.c: In function 'check_parameters':
/<<PKGBUILDDIR>>/src/plugin/protocol_oidc.c:272:45: error: implicit declaration
of function 'r_jwks_import_from_str'; did you mean 'r_jwks_import_from_uri'?
[-Werror=implicit-function-declaration]
272 | if (r_jwks_init(&jwks) != RHN_OK || r_jwks_import_from_str(jwks,
json_string_value(json_object_get(j_params, "jwks-public"))) != RHN_OK) {
| ^~~~~~~~~~~~~~~~~~~~~~
| r_jwks_import_from_uri
I initially saw this on a raspbian bookworm-staging autobuilder, but I was also
able to reproduce
it in a Debian sid chroot.
I found upstream patches fixing the above errors and applied them in raspbian
bookworm-staging,
I also imported the cross-fetch fix into raspbian bookworm-staging from Debian
sid. After doing
so I was able to get a successful build of glewlwyd. A debdiff should appear
soon at
https://debdiffs.raspbian.org/main/g/glewlwyd
P.S. The cross-fetch fix also seems to be blocked from migrating to debian
testing as a result
of an autopkgtest failure.
--- End Message ---
--- Begin Message ---
Source: glewlwyd
Source-Version: 2.6.0-1
Done: Nicolas Mora <babelou...@debian.org>
We believe that the bug you reported is fixed in the latest version of
glewlwyd,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to 1000...@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Nicolas Mora <babelou...@debian.org> (supplier of updated glewlwyd package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mas...@ftp-master.debian.org)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Mon, 22 Nov 2021 20:50:23 -0500
Source: glewlwyd
Architecture: source
Version: 2.6.0-1
Distribution: unstable
Urgency: medium
Maintainer: Debian IoT Maintainers
<debian-iot-maintain...@lists.alioth.debian.org>
Changed-By: Nicolas Mora <babelou...@debian.org>
Closes: 994048 996790 1000471
Changes:
glewlwyd (2.6.0-1) unstable; urgency=medium
.
* New upstream release (Closes: #1000471)
* d/patches: Remove webauthn buffer overflow patch
* d/watch: fix filenamemangle
* d/control: Update standards version to 4.6.0 (no change)
* d/po/nl.po: Update Dutch translation (Closes: #996790)
* d/po/de.po: Update German translation (Closes: #994048)
* d/salsa-ci.yml: enable salsa CI
Checksums-Sha1:
7b0a474e48fdbc019cecb20788204ad0857402fa 2572 glewlwyd_2.6.0-1.dsc
941776e08b08a6bec9b7ee9e0fcc5ead60f1dc40 5637689 glewlwyd_2.6.0.orig.tar.gz
ed48c74b8e43eb34b7109e68071ea9b22dbf8a05 29216 glewlwyd_2.6.0-1.debian.tar.xz
67c43d93854626edf9f333d93d3581601132d1ae 19236 glewlwyd_2.6.0-1_amd64.buildinfo
Checksums-Sha256:
cf5a23ac1382e51701a52ec621ec07f98b56654170e060c759edc8c8108b0d40 2572
glewlwyd_2.6.0-1.dsc
94088f59bbff54cdda273f46fb86900ccff42ed34de5262a69ef1e34dfa8f96d 5637689
glewlwyd_2.6.0.orig.tar.gz
a90092f441ee810d309bf9159cb689dee17d984b073ce1703896722971b4b3d9 29216
glewlwyd_2.6.0-1.debian.tar.xz
7cc655aaaf20f6f4a2cb59a6b1d399b44d7d0d4fa068a604cf44a0ab4c70e24f 19236
glewlwyd_2.6.0-1_amd64.buildinfo
Files:
8d6017eab78cdbda2de6955a2eda1b96 2572 web optional glewlwyd_2.6.0-1.dsc
32c25b8c2af0b3d7723fd3b36baa46a0 5637689 web optional
glewlwyd_2.6.0.orig.tar.gz
51f0055457d21d87b195af992d2b7b80 29216 web optional
glewlwyd_2.6.0-1.debian.tar.xz
002e6cfa9df27b26c7074f8b678b3716 19236 web optional
glewlwyd_2.6.0-1_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QIzBAEBCgAdFiEEhAWwL8wo75dEyPJT/oITlEC9IrkFAmGdaOQACgkQ/oITlEC9
Irlqdw//TWD9MLzoRDE5iTX7iLgkfIeH1S+qe1Aj7a+tLoKsDmNh+sR5yXIYAU3e
sPc4+LfFFnhqrUWnB4DkuiQd2qXA/ulVeFgW0zb0yVodVo4gh2KUP+SkjSrqHo5c
OzC4h09BDepi5ngoilKsoKBexFo9Fw20D/atwzHTyClJOIrTbSA0XyJ7o6spLulV
NK10Mc3OtIYaNyUdW00Ui2iXBhGaxufqXYCCmfgf6aQNN763gIAaQ86Rd7AI593I
VuJhDFP9stmEvxW5N/rHHO/yCFLbI0KZWlIXpmXaU69EOuWvA9MkIS16vUj1FG9z
PTViSzkDk1mdNzKi2Y6u5GptGoZwnm0oU2/IBEUP4OATrFCz76IinlxUc3mSnzXm
t6824ka5pxEe9+z+oBe8u8lfvrPmgbgDVYCEJw9Ooq8kRXnV7dgEBP+oLIbJ+TtX
zlauniVC56fFz3ZQTIFhvpkRll2eyoNDjZkWLn19qNWmHknJ8MeCNnr82deKKG0u
FcRc3My7obTCxwJeV9P3Xn4UDzMkxNemghGXsGRferyqZoOyvn0EYCZDN8A95JcA
+WZc2efA5M5BAf0eRJSOYGrEU8M8xAM2Feh/igeaM7/KSKo0GTJvZARYrzs0mwBZ
JYnRJmlklBYdb9vQlQ1W81bKlEo8TnK6Luav3C6rnoJd1qSZXNM=
=7lAR
-----END PGP SIGNATURE-----
--- End Message ---